Tonight I’m going to do something messy. Several months ago I bought some spice racks to store due in. I was worried about the dye colors fading in the bottles so I covered the bottles with electrician's tape. Tonight I'm going to open all those packets of dye and place them into the bottles. Hopefully one day I can find some black bottles to replace these bottles, but this will work until that time. It's much more organized, at least. Now I' ll be able to tell what colors I have at a glance.
